As for capacitors just use what ever has the lowest ESR.
Panasonic FM's are highly regarded.
I put in Nichicon Fine Golds around the phono stage, Elna Silmic II's everywhere else, may replace those with Panasonic FM's.
Low resonance Vishay cans on the last smoothing stage.
The difficulty was mostly finding caps that would fit in the footprint of the board and height,
Buying more capacitors than the list amount was also necessary for matching.
PSU bridge rectifiers, replace with low noise singles, BYV29-600's/ MUR 420-480
